She was a long-time member of Sand Branch United Methodist Church. Elsie worked alongside her husband, Earl, as owner of McNutt Grocery, a fixture in the Ramsey community. She was dedicated to serving her church and community. Most will remember the Christmas treat bags that were lovingly put together by her and her family. She took pride in maintaining the church grounds for more than 40 years. Elsie will be remembered for her selflessness and love for others. She was a dedicated care giver for many family members over her lifetime.
